Asphalt shingle and the roofs we see most in San Ramon

Asphalt shingle is the workhorse roof across San Ramon, and most of what we see are post-war and early-1900s homes on their second or third roof. Modern architectural shingles last longer and look far better than the three-tab roofs they replace, shrug off wind better, and — where East Bay Inland homes sit near wildland edges — can be specified as Class-A fire-rated assemblies that meet California's WUI code. On shaded and fog-facing slopes we also plan for moss and debris, because in this climate a shingle roof usually fails from moisture and neglect before it fails from age.

What roofing costs in San Ramon

We publish real ranges up front because "call for pricing" wastes everyone's time. Here is what San Ramon homeowners typically pay in 2026:

Roofing serviceTypical Bay Area cost (2026)
Roof leak repair$500–$2,000 (avg ~$1,200)
General roof repair$800–$2,500
Architectural shingle replacement$9–$14 / sq ft
Tile roof replacement$18–$30 / sq ft
Flat / low-slope (TPO or torch-down)$8–$14 / sq ft
Cool-roof coating$4–$7 / sq ft
Roof inspectionFree with estimate · ~$250–$500 standalone

Directional 2026 Bay Area ranges — your written estimate is free and specific to your roof.

Your actual price depends on the size and pitch of your roof, the material, how easy the roof is to access, and what the inspection finds underneath — and we put all of it in writing before any work starts. A typical Bay Area replacement runs $18,000–$45,000, and because a new roof is a real investment, we also offer financing so a sound roof in San Ramon fits a monthly budget.

Permits, codes and your roof

A reroof in San Ramon needs a permit — from the San Francisco Department of Building Inspection (DBI) in the city, or your local building department elsewhere in the Bay Area — and we pull it. We also handle Title 24 plus Chapter 7A Class-A fire-rated assemblies in WUI zones, so your finished roof passes inspection the first time. If your home sits in a historic district or HOA-governed pocket of Windemere, we match materials and profiles to what the rules require — getting this wrong is an expensive mistake we help you avoid.
